#9ea850 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9ea850 is composed of 62% red, 65.9%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.4%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 66.8 degrees, a saturation of 35.5% and a lightness of 48.6%. #9ea850 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a0 with #3d5100.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#9ea850

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080904 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#9ea850

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818276 is the less saturated color, while #d9f404 is the most saturated one.
